    Bus

    Start at the main bus station in Fes, known as Gare Routière. Look for buses that are heading to 'Bhalil' or 'Moulay Yacoub'. Purchase your ticket from the ticket counter. The bus will take you directly to Bhalil, and the journey usually takes around 40 minutes. Once you arrive in Bhalil, you can explore the village on foot. Make sure to ask the bus driver or fellow passengers to help you identify the right stop for Bhalil.

    Discover more about Bhalil

    Bhalil, a picturesque village in Morocco, offers a unique glimpse into the country's rich cultural tapestry and stunning natural beauty. Famous for its troglodyte dwellings, this enchanting village is carved into the hillside, providing an extraordinary living experience that dates back centuries. As you wander through the narrow, winding alleys, the charm of traditional Moroccan architecture and the inviting warmth of the local community will envelop you. The village is known for its friendly locals who are eager to share their way of life, making it an ideal spot for cultural immersion. One of the highlights of visiting Bhalil is exploring its historic homes, many of which are still inhabited. These cave-like structures provide a fascinating insight into how the Berber people have adapted to their environment over generations. Besides the architectural wonders, the village is surrounded by lush greenery and panoramic views of the surrounding hills, presenting countless opportunities for photography and peaceful contemplation. Bhalil is also a hub of artisan craftsmanship, where you can find beautifully crafted pottery and textiles. Supporting local artisans not only helps preserve traditional skills but also allows you to take home a piece of Moroccan heritage.
